Amenities
Pamper yourself with a visit to the spa, which offers massages, body treatments, and facials. You're sure to appreciate the recreational amenities, which include 3 outdoor pools, a nightclub, and outdoor tennis courts. This property also features compl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and babysitting (surcharge).
Business amenities
Featured amenities include a computer station, dry cleaning/laundry services, and a 24-hour front desk. Free self parking is available onsite.
Dining
Grab a bite to eat at one of the property's 5 restaurants, or stay in and take advantage of the 24-hour room service. Snacks are also available at the coffee shop/cafe. Relax with a refreshing drink from the poolside bar or one of the 5 bars/lounges.
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 272 guestrooms featuring free minibar items and flat-screen televisions. Rooms have private balconies.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ers.
Location
With a stay at Sandos Finisterra All Inclusive, you'll be centrally located in Cabo San Lucas, a 5-minute walk from Marina Del Rey and a 2-minute drive from Land's End. This all-inclusive property is 1.1 mi (1.8 km) from The Arch and 4 mi (6.5 km) from Cabo San Lucas Country Club.

What guests think
At Sandos Finisterra All Inclusive, travelers consistently praise the friendly staff, walkable location by the marina, and striking views of the Pacific and marina, while noting dated rooms in places, occasional maintenance issues, and a non-swimmable on-site beach.
Most describe the property and rooms as clean, though some reported cloudy or buggy pools. Dining feedback is mixed: many enjoyed the breakfast buffet, Cupcake Cafe, and some restaurants, while others found food repetitive or average and drinks inconsistent, with occasional long waits. Amenities include several pools, daily activities and shows, and a well liked spa, but recurring comments mention elevator outages and steep hills that may challenge mobility. Expect a scenic, lively stay where standout service balances some aging areas.
